We are seeking a Construction Manager to join our team on a variety of high-profile commercial & hospitality projects. The ideal candidate will have at least 10 years of experience in a project management or construction superintendent role, preferably in commercial office or hospitality projects.
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ree from an accredited school, or equal
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el and Project
Ability to read and understand drawings including, but not limited to: Floor plans, Interior elevations, Reflected ceiling plans, Millwork details, and Finish schedules.
Excellent and effective written, verbal, and team management skills.
Broad knowledge base of general construction with In-depth experience with interior construction
Strong leadership, organization, ability to multitask and adapt to a variety of challenges.
Experience with field management of projects and trades
Skilled In rough and finish carpentry Is preferred
Proficient In Spanish Is preferred but not required
Role Responsibilities:
Manage construction processes such as budgeting, bidding, budgeting, contract management, scheduling, RFIs, submittals, monthly draws/Invoices, and close out
Prepare and manage the project budget, project schedule and project cash flow
Assist with code-related construction Issues
Prepare project status reports for clients and team members as needed
Act as point person with BSP staff, tenants and subcontractors, managing communications and documenting decisions throughout all phases of construction
Coordinate and collaborate with BSP design, property management and leasing and 3rd party consultants on all construction related Issues and maintain professional relationships.
Process and track purchases and deliveries to align with overall project schedules.
Consult with subcontractors, vendors, and fabricators and secure appropriate proposals.
Participate in construction administration tasks and regular site visits to lead and monitor progress, quality control, safety and personnel.
Job Type: Full-time, Salaried position, 40+ hours/weekly
Salary Range: $100k - $150k
Location: 600 W Van Buren office and various project sites throughout Chicago
Benefits offered: Paid time off; Health, vision, and dental, insurance; 401k, etc
